Description
| - 2 -Substituted phenylpropynoic acids 1 and - in less details - 2 -substituted (E)-phenyliminoacetic acids 3 were investigated theoretically as model for theortho substitution, in which direct steric interaction is prevented by the extended side chain bearing the reaction centre. Energies of the acid molecules and of their deprotonated forms were calculated within the framework of the density functional theory at the level B3LYP/6- 311+G(d,p)//B3LYP/6-311+G(d,p). The substituent effects were evaluated in terms of isodesmic reactions, on the one hand for the acidity, on the other separately for the acid molecules or for the anions. Contrary to the expectation, the steric interaction of the substituent with the side chain is rather strong. The substituent effects represent a blend of polar and steric effects, and cannot serve for deriving any set of standard ortho substituent constants free of proximity effects as it was originally believed.
